From ffce0bc4f2e2fbc46d5bc79757a292edbc9306a6 Mon Sep 17 00:00:00 2001 From: Peng Li Date: Wed, 27 May 2015 00:34:48 +0800 Subject: [PATCH] emacs: ggtags config, using ido-completion, and split vertically --- emacs.d/init.el |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/emacs.d/init.el b/emacs.d/init.el index 39841b6..95901d5 100644 --- a/emacs.d/init.el +++ b/emacs.d/init.el @@ -163,17 +163,21 @@ ;;;; show default directory on mode-line (ggtags-mode 1) +;; using ido-completion for ggtags +;; https://github.com/leoliu/ggtags/issues/56 +(setq ggtags-completing-read-function + (lambda (&rest args) + (apply #'ido-completing-read + (car args) + (all-completions "" ggtags-completion-table) + (cddr args)))) -;;j;(setq ggtags-completing-read-function -;;j; (lambda (&rest args) -;;j; (apply #'ido-completing-read -;;j; (car args) -;;j; (all-completions "" ggtags-completion-table) -;;j; (cddr args)))) ;; gnu global support ;(require 'semantic/db) ;(global-semanticdb-minor-mode 1) +(custom-set-variables + '(ggtags-split-window-function (quote split-window-vertically))) -- 2.11.0